"Max Johnson, cofounder of Briix, noted that he used to work fluidly for hours in Claude, but now he can exhaust his token allowance quickly, forcing him to plan his day around these limits."
"An Anthropic spokesperson stated that the company is adjusting its five-hour session limits to manage growing demand for Claude and has introduced efficiency improvements to offset the impact."
"About 7% of users will hit session limits they wouldn't have previously, reshaping how some workers structure their time and prioritize tasks."
"Johnson mentioned that having to wait for an evening reset can introduce a new kind of fragmentation in his day, affecting productivity."
